What Are the Prerequisites for CRISC Certification?

Eligibility Requirements
  • Three (3) or more years of experience in IT risk management and IS control. No experience waivers or substitutions.

What is CRISC Exam Pattern and Question Format?

Exam Format
  • Exam Type: Multiple-Choice Questions  
  • No. of Questions: 150 
  • Duration: 4 Hours (240 Mins) 
  • Passing score: 450 or Higher out of 800 
  • Languages: English, Chinese Simplified, Spanish, Korean. 

CRISC® Training Curriculum

Course Agenda

A - ORGANIZATIONAL GOVERNANCE

  • Organizational Strategy, Goals, and Objectives 
  • Organizational Structure, Roles and Responsibilities
  • Organizational Culture
  • Policies and Standards
  • Business Processes
  • Organizational Assets

B - RISK GOVERNANCE

  • Enterprise Risk Management and Risk Management Framework
  • Three Lines of Defense Risk Profile
  • Risk Appetite and Risk Tolerance
  • Legal, Regulatory, and Contractual Requirements
  • Professional Ethics of Risk Management
